this post was submitted on 29 Oct 2024
52 points (94.8% liked)

Ask Lemmy

26968 readers
1068 users here now

A Fediverse community for open-ended, thought provoking questions

Please don't post about US Politics. If you need to do this, try !politicaldiscussion@lemmy.world


Rules: (interactive)


1) Be nice and; have funDoxxing, trolling, sealioning, racism, and toxicity are not welcomed in AskLemmy. Remember what your mother said: if you can't say something nice, don't say anything at all. In addition, the site-wide Lemmy.world terms of service also apply here. Please familiarize yourself with them


2) All posts must end with a '?'This is sort of like Jeopardy. Please phrase all post titles in the form of a proper question ending with ?


3) No spamPlease do not flood the community with nonsense. Actual suspected spammers will be banned on site. No astroturfing.


4) NSFW is okay, within reasonJust remember to tag posts with either a content warning or a [NSFW] tag. Overtly sexual posts are not allowed, please direct them to either !asklemmyafterdark@lemmy.world or !asklemmynsfw@lemmynsfw.com. NSFW comments should be restricted to posts tagged [NSFW].


5) This is not a support community.
It is not a place for 'how do I?', type questions. If you have any questions regarding the site itself or would like to report a community, please direct them to Lemmy.world Support or email info@lemmy.world. For other questions check our partnered communities list, or use the search function.


Reminder: The terms of service apply here too.

Partnered Communities:

Tech Support

No Stupid Questions

You Should Know

Reddit

Jokes

Ask Ouija


Logo design credit goes to: tubbadu


founded 1 year ago
MODERATORS
 

I am working in IT and some of my colleagues are talking about getting certifications for a particular domain within our field of work. These certifications are expensive and requires time and effort. So are they worth getting?

all 28 comments
sorted by: hot top controversial new old
[–] Im_old@lemmy.world 50 points 3 weeks ago (1 children)

Yes, for mainly 2 reasons:

  • it shows your employer that you are willing to learn and grow (and they could even pay for it)
  • it adds value to your CV in case you want to leave
[–] neidu2@feddit.nl 12 points 3 weeks ago

It's hard to find more compact correctness than this comment right here.

[–] vk6flab@lemmy.radio 19 points 3 weeks ago (2 children)

I'm an industry professional in ICT with 40 years experience.

I've come to form the view that industry certification is a vendor lock-in process created solely for the purpose of generating a guaranteed income stream for that vendor.

If your employer wants to spend its money on certification, by all means go for it as a learning experience.

If you have to pay for it yourself, I've yet to see any evidence that they represent a return on investment of any kind in your career.

That's not to say that learning should be abandoned, quite the opposite. In this industry, if you're not learning, you're going backwards.

Stay curious, read verociosly and try to figure out how stuff works and more importantly, how it breaks.

[–] sundray@lemmus.org 5 points 3 weeks ago

If your employer wants to spend its money on certification, by all means go for it

For real, if you haven't already try to find every bit of employer-paid training that's available, it's worth looking into. My workplace has a corp Microsoft learning account that will pay for one certification test a year, and other deals with online training platforms for free classes that don't result in "certificates" exactly, but do provided verifiable proof of completion you can post to your LinkedIn or socials. (The real benefit is the knowledge you gain of course, but it's nice to have some acknowledgment of what you've learned.)

[–] Appoxo@lemmy.dbzer0.com 1 points 3 weeks ago

Maybe for vendor products but for general purpose knowledge like routing, auditsand so on? Maybe as a stepping stone to continue learning by yourself.

[–] 1984@lemmy.today 10 points 3 weeks ago (1 children)

Yeah it has helped me in my career.

I did the most difficult aws certifications but turns out it doesn't matter - even the intro certs are seen as very valuable by hiring managers, the ones where you just learn the name of services.

[–] mesamunefire@lemmy.world 3 points 3 weeks ago (1 children)

Heh yeah the AWS ones are just product placement and a tiny bit of configuration soup later on.

[–] 1984@lemmy.today 3 points 3 weeks ago* (last edited 3 weeks ago) (1 children)

It's actually annoying. In aws world, only aws solutions are even mentioned. I notified only after certification that there are many valid use cases for not using Ami's for example. Aws pretty much recommends making a new ami for every little change you make on servers, and if you have a fleet of hundreds of servers and want to change a small config on them, that means building and replacing hundreds of Ami's.

Compare that to ansible that can quickly and in parallell make the change everywhere in seconds.

The immutable infrastructure thing sounds really good in theory but has flaws in practice. The benefits are there but at a big time/money/complexity cost.

[–] mesamunefire@lemmy.world 1 points 3 weeks ago

I learned terraform and that helped. But I started in on and ansable/chef.

[–] linearchaos@lemmy.world 9 points 3 weeks ago

Absolutely worth it.

During your next review cycle hey boss I improved my education I'm now n-certified. I'd like to be considered for a promotion where I can better use my new skills.

Between the lines: You're either going to give me a bump in salary or position or I'm now more marketable than I was and I may just leave.

And on the upside, if you do leave you are now worth more money.

[–] slazer2au@lemmy.world 9 points 3 weeks ago* (last edited 3 weeks ago)

Yes, the more certified employees a company has the more discount they may get with some vendors.

It will also help future job prospects.

Some employees will also pay the cost of the exam so you are not out of pocket if you pass.

[–] ramble81@lemm.ee 8 points 3 weeks ago (1 children)

I’m gonna go against the grain here and say no, especially in IT. I’m a hiring manager and I can’t tell you the number of people that are loaded with certs and only understand rote memorization and not actually practical application of topics. I prefer to see the experience and my interview questions actually get into real examples to see your thought process, instead of spitting out a list of facts.

Now, if you don’t have the experience, that can potentially offset things some, but I’ve always found experience and application are key for any of my hires.

[–] 1984@lemmy.today 3 points 3 weeks ago* (last edited 3 weeks ago)

Many managers have no clue what is even inside a cert, and gets impressed by any cert, including free ones you get for showing up (no tests).

[–] Wolf314159@startrek.website 5 points 3 weeks ago

Expensive certifications that your employer will reimburse you for that potentially increase your earnings potential and value in the job market if you do change employers? Are those worth getting? Yes. Employer not paying you for them? Still, maybe yes. Do you really need to ask? Or are you looking for an excuse to not do the thing recommended by your mentors and that's not giving you instant gratification and a dopamine hit (like this place does)?

[–] scytale@lemm.ee 4 points 3 weeks ago

Never pay for professional certs out of your own pocket. Your employer should be paying for it. If they are willing to pay for it without a bond (I know some companies tie you down for a specific time and if you quit before then, you have to pay it back), then go for it.

[–] Volkditty@lemmy.world 4 points 3 weeks ago (1 children)

I have only ever bothered getting certifications if they were a job requirement or when I was looking to pad my resume before making a move.

Ask around, your company may have some kind of tuition assistance or vouchers to cover exam fees for relevant certs.

[–] seaQueue@lemmy.world 5 points 3 weeks ago* (last edited 3 weeks ago)

Ask around, your company may have some kind of tuition assistance or vouchers to cover exam fees for relevant certs.

Whenever possible take advantage of your company's continuing education budget. Get relevant certs, take university extension classes, buy study materials and books, etc.

[–] faltryka@lemmy.world 3 points 3 weeks ago

Depends on the role. Certs are basically just a marginal improvement with some but not all companies automated screening of your resume.

I do lots of interviews and could not care less about certs. They are not a reliable indicator of capability or talent.

[–] Xtallll@lemmy.blahaj.zone 3 points 3 weeks ago

Government contracts will often require certain certifications.

[–] Mojave@lemmy.world 3 points 3 weeks ago

Ask your company to pay for the certs. At best you get free certs and can then leave them and make more money somewhere. At worst they say no.

Going from zero certs to getting my Sec+ landed me a better job with a new company and nearly doubled my income. (Cloud architecture engineer). Can't speak to any other certs.

[–] sevan@lemmy.ca 3 points 3 weeks ago

I would do a search for job listings that would be the jobs you would be applying for if you chose to leave your job or were laid off. Do the job descriptions list the certifications you are thinking about getting? If so, it might be worth pursuing, especially if you can get your current employer to pay for it.

For example, almost every project manager job lists PMP certification. If you are currently a PM and don't have it, you might want it just in case you get laid off to improve your chances of getting a new job. Otherwise, you might be up against 10 other candidates with just as much experience, but 3 of them have a cert and you don't even get a screening interview.

Have you asked these colleagues what they're hoping to gain from those certs to see why they think they're worthwhile? Might just be people looking for a little variety in the work day if it's something they can do on company time.

[–] Assman@sh.itjust.works 1 points 3 weeks ago (1 children)

This isn't the place to ask. Go figure out if your industry cares about these certifications. I am a software engineer certified in nothing and I've never been asked about them. Pretty sure it's the opposite for IT/infrastructure type roles, but again, you're just gonna get anecdotes here and not really accurate information.

[–] 1984@lemmy.today 2 points 3 weeks ago

You don't get asked for them - companies pick someone with the cert before you and you will never know. :)

[–] NineMileTower@lemmy.world 1 points 3 weeks ago
[–] peopleproblems@lemmy.world 1 points 3 weeks ago

In my experience? If you are going to do the formal classes and work that lines up with a certificate, might as well do all of it and get it. It can't hurt.

At the same time, there is no real reason a cert is better than experience. It's more of easy proof of the date that you learned the technology, so it stuff has changed it's easy to show you the new stuff.

[–] Toes@ani.social 0 points 3 weeks ago

In my opinion the actual cert is not worth pursuing unless you're trying to negotiate a promotion or find a new job.

Now if your employer is willing to pay for it great. (But I stopped paying for such things out of my own pocket.)

But the knowledge is what's valuable. You can study nearly anything in the IT field for free.